begin process at 2012 02 14 21:50:30
  Trouver un code source :
 
dans
 
Accueil > Forum > 

Archive Visual Basic & VB.NET

 > 

Archives Visual Basic

 > 

J'AI BESOIN D'AIDE !!!! :)

 > 

petit probleme urgent


Derniers messages déposésPoser une question dans le forum ou lancer une discussion

petit probleme urgent

vendredi 19 décembre 2003 à 16:54:47 | petit probleme urgent

maryouma


Salut
je veux ouvrir un fichier matlab en mode exécution à partir d'une feuille vb
pour cela j'ai ecrit le code suivant :
Private Declare Function shellExecute Lib "shell32.dll" Alias "shellExecute a" (ByVal HWMD As Long, ByVal LPOperation As String, ByVal LPval As String, ByVal LPParameter As String, ByVal LPDirectory As String, ByVal Nshowcmd As Long) As Long

pour l'appel:
Call shellExecute(Me.HWMD, "d:\IIA3\cpi\tp3\test.m", "", vbNullString, 1)

j'ai eu comme message d'erreur :"méthode ou membre de données introuvable"

est ce que vous pouvez m'aider à résoudre ce prob
merci


vendredi 19 décembre 2003 à 17:09:33 | Re : petit probleme urgent

Arsena

ecrit:
HWND et verifie le chemin de ton fichier

Call shellExecute(Me.HWND, "d:\IIA3\cpi\tp3\test.m", "", vbNullString, 1)


MD
vendredi 19 décembre 2003 à 17:14:58 | Re : petit probleme urgent

Arsena

ou plutot:

ShellExecute Me.hwnd, vbNullString, "Le chemin de ton fichier", vbNullString, "C:\", SW_SHOWNORMA

A+
MD
vendredi 19 décembre 2003 à 20:37:12 | Re : petit probleme urgent

maryouma


Salut
j'ai vérifié le chemin de mon fichier, il est juste
j'ai esayé les deux solutions mais j'ai pas eu de résultats, en fait pour la 1ere j'ai eu ce message"cet argument n'est pas facultatif", pour la 2eme, j'ai eu cet erreur"Point d'entrée shellExecute a d'une DDL introuvable dans shell32.dll"
Quoi faire ?
merci
samedi 20 décembre 2003 à 08:16:47 | Re : petit probleme urgent

Arsena

Un exemple de code qui ouvre un fichier


Option Explicit
'ShellExecute Lance un programme a partir de l'extention de fichier
Private Declare Function ShellExecute Lib "shell32.dll" Alias "ShellExecuteA" ( _
ByVal hwnd As Long, _
ByVal lpOperation As String, _
ByVal lpFile As String, _
ByVal lpParameters As String, _
ByVal lpDirectory As String, _
ByVal nShowCmd As Long) As Long
Const SW_SHOWNORMAL = 1

Private Sub Form_Load()

'Me.hwnd = Le handle de la feuille
'lpOperation = "Open"
'lpFile = Chemin du fichier a lancer
'lpParameters = vbNullString
'lpDirectory = "C:\"
'nShowCmd = Etat de la fenetre (SW_SHOWNORMAL)
ShellExecute Me.hwnd, "Open", _
"LeCheminDeTonFichier", _
vbNullString, "C:\", SW_SHOWNORMAL
Unload Me
End
End Sub



A+ et bonne prog
MD


Cette discussion est classée dans : long, string, urgent, probleme, shellexecute


Répondre à ce message

Sujets en rapport avec ce message

probleme avec shellexecute [ par theantho ] je suis débutant en vb et le truc c quand cliquant sur un bouton sa me lance ma messagerie par défault avec un message prédéfiniet ensuite simuler l'e ShellExecute [ par JeffC1977 ] Bonjour,J'ai un bug avec le shellexecute.J'ai recu ces lignes de commandes mais il y a quelques info que je ne saisi pas.Private Declare Function Shel ShellExecute et ADO [ par JeffC1977 ] J'utilise VB6 ADO et ACCESS dans mon programme Salut... je veux utiliser un ShellExecute mais ca fonctione pas.. et je comrpends vraiment pas pourqu besoin d'explikation SVP [ par tom ] bonjourje voudrais savoir comment faire pour faire afficher pour une page web pour kel soit minimizé aussitot appelé.Declare Function ShellExecute Lib ne marche pas encore [ par newtonisem ] J'ai tapé ce code pour ouvrir le fichierPrivate Declare Function ShellExecute Lib "shell32.dll" Alias "ShellExecuteA" (ByVal hwnd As Long, ByVal lpOpe ouvrir un site [ par jarod59 ] salut,jarrete pa de voir ce code la pr ouvrir un site Declare Function ShellExecute Lib "shell32.dll" Alias "ShellExecuteA" (ByVal hwnd As Long, ByVal pb avec shellexecute [ par deubal ] salut, je boss sur une bdd access 2000 et pour ouvrir un fichier j'utilise l'api shellexecute, j'utilise le code suivant mais ca marche pas.*****'ds l shellexecute aidez moi! [ par ticrain ] Je dois ouvrir des fichier excel et word que joré selectionner dans une listobox en appuyant sur un bouton:est ce que qqun peut m'aider je c que shell Probleme compatibilite XP / 2000 [ par Trisoul ] Bonsoir,J'ai termine mon appli, elle fonctionne sur mon poste.Je place l'exe et sa base de donnee sur un serveur.L'exe fonctionne lorsque je le lance Appel DLL dans un module ne marche pas [ par andrebernard ] Bonjour à tousVoila, suite a plusieurs POSTS dans ce Forum, j'ai essayé de faire appel a ma DLL non-activeX qui a été crée par un autre language que V


Nos sponsors


Sondage...

CalendriCode

Février 2012
LMMJVSD
  12345
6789101112
13141516171819
20212223242526
272829    

Consulter la suite du CalendriCode

 
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ils.
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és

Google Coop CodeS-SourceS Google Coop CodeS-SourceS
Temps d'éxécution de la page : 0,718 sec (3)

Nous contacter | Annoncer sur CodeS-SourceS | Mentions légales